All three main political parties in Britain pledged to seek
voter approval of a proposed European Union Constitution in
2005. Rejection by French and Dutch voters killed the Constitution
and made a referendum in Briton unnecessary. But parliament
has now voted against allowing a referendum on the new European
Treaty that contains all of the provisions of the old Constitution.
